32BITS , 80Mhz Pinguino with PIC32MX440F256H

Yes, the ready-to-use version arrived, and its from one of my favourite developers of boards out there-OLIMEX !! They have got us used to top quality stuff, no doubt !!
So THIS BOARD , with a PIC32 MX440F256H, uses the PINGUINO IDE , with the same kind of language that Arduino got us used to !
I am also doing a PINGUINO DIY version of it with the PIC32MX250F128B DIP, that takes advantage of the USB bootloader for the PIC32.
